Sometime in the year 2000, Konami teamed up with iNiS Corporation, Hands On Entertainment Inc., and Oracion to develop Beatmania DA!! (not to be confused with Beatmania DA!! DA!! DA!! on PlayStation 2), a typing video game based on the Beatmania series, for Windows, Macintosh, and the PlayStation. Additionally, a sequel titled "Beatmania BEST DA!!" was released in the same year, followed by a PlayStation 2 version based on this game in 2002. Beatmania DA!! was also the only PC game in the Beatmania series to be released until Beatmania IIDX INFINITAS, which was released on December 1st, 2015.[1]

Gameplay

Beatmania DA!! plays similarly to the arcade games, except for the fact that it uses the keyboard as a controller. Most of the songs are based on the arcade version but modified to accommodate with the altered gameplay.[1]

Other variations between the two games included Beatmania DA!! running in 640x480 resolution as opposed to the original's 512x384 resolution as well as the Konami logo being removed.

Availability

Due to the obscurity of the game, finding any copy of it was very hard until August 16th, 2016, when "Bhyper" uploaded it to Mediafire. However, a handful of videos about the game has been made available on the internet.[2]
